Directed by Alyssa Cheng (’26) Experience an emotional roller-coaster journey with Duncan Macmillan's acclaimed play, Every Brilliant Thing. This profoundly moving and surprisingly funny solo show, performed by Vir Gupta (’25), explores the lengths we go to for those we love, and the power of finding joy in the everyday and in the little things.
When a young boy's mother attempts suicide, he begins a list of everything that's brilliant about the world – everything worth living for. As he grows, so does the list, becoming a lifeline and a testament to the resilience of the human spirit.
Through interactive storytelling and a deeply personal narrative, Every Brilliant Thing invites the audience to participate in creating a shared experience of hope and healing. Prepare to laugh, cry, and leave with a renewed appreciation for the extraordinary in the ordinary of our lives.
